Key Insights

  • Core Web Vitals are now part of Google's Page Experience ranking signals, focusing on pagespeed, visual stability, and interactivity.
  • The three main metrics of Core Web Vitals are Largest Contentful Paint (LCP), Cumulative Layout Shift (CLS), and First Input Delay (FID).
  • Improving Core Web Vitals can enhance user experience, reduce page abandonment, and potentially improve SEO rankings.
  • Field data from real users and lab test data from tools are both essential for assessing Core Web Vitals performance.
  • Largest Contentful Paint (LCP) should load within 2.5 seconds to ensure optimal visual loading performance.
  • Cumulative Layout Shift (CLS) measures visual stability, with a recommended score of less than 0.1 to avoid content shifts.
  • First Input Delay (FID) measures interactivity, with a target of less than 100 milliseconds for responsive user interactions.
  • Optimizing Core Web Vitals involves addressing server response times, render-blocking resources, and optimizing JavaScript and CSS.

Questions & Answers

Q: What are Core Web Vitals?

Core Web Vitals are a set of three metrics that measure specific aspects of a webpage’s performance, including visual load, visual stability, and interactivity. These metrics are Largest Contentful Paint (LCP), Cumulative Layout Shift (CLS), and First Input Delay (FID). They are now part of Google's Page Experience ranking signals.

Q: Why are Core Web Vitals important for SEO?

Core Web Vitals are important for SEO because they are part of Google's Page Experience ranking signals. Improving these metrics can enhance user experience by reducing page abandonment and increasing engagement, which can indirectly affect search rankings. They help ensure that websites are fast, stable, and interactive, contributing to a better overall user experience.

Q: How can you measure Core Web Vitals?

Core Web Vitals can be measured using field data and lab test data. Field data reflects real user experiences and is gathered from the Chrome User Experience Report (CrUX), while lab test data is generated by tools like PageSpeed Insights and Chrome Dev Tools. Both types of data are essential for understanding and optimizing website performance.

Q: What is the Largest Contentful Paint (LCP) metric?

Largest Contentful Paint (LCP) is a metric that measures the loading performance of a webpage. It focuses on the time it takes for the largest visible element, such as an image or a block of text, to load within the viewport. The recommended target for LCP is to load within 2.5 seconds to ensure good user experience.

Q: What causes poor Cumulative Layout Shift (CLS) scores?

Poor Cumulative Layout Shift (CLS) scores are often caused by elements shifting unexpectedly on a webpage. Common causes include images and ads without dimensions, dynamically injected content, and late-loading fonts or styles. Ensuring elements have defined sizes and loading resources in a controlled manner can help improve CLS scores.

Q: What is First Input Delay (FID) and why is it important?

First Input Delay (FID) measures the time from when a user first interacts with a page to when the browser responds. It reflects the interactivity of a webpage. A low FID score indicates that a page is quick to respond to user inputs, enhancing user experience. The target for FID is less than 100 milliseconds.

Q: How can JavaScript affect Core Web Vitals?

JavaScript can significantly impact Core Web Vitals, particularly First Input Delay (FID), by blocking the main thread and delaying interactivity. Optimizing JavaScript involves breaking up long tasks, deferring non-essential scripts, and reducing execution time. These actions help ensure a responsive and interactive user experience.

Q: Do Core Web Vitals significantly impact SEO rankings?

While Core Web Vitals are part of Google's Page Experience signals, their impact on SEO rankings may vary. They are unlikely to be the sole factor determining rankings but can act as a tiebreaker between similar results. Improving Core Web Vitals is beneficial for user experience and can indirectly influence rankings.
